All this over a word even that dictionary.com site itself says:

Origin of gyp1
1885–90, Americanism ; back formation from Gypsy

Usage note
Gyp in the meanings “to swindle” or “a person who swindles” is sometimes perceived as insulting to or by Gypsies, since it stereotypes them as swindlers. However, gyp has apparently never been used as a deliberate ethnic slur, and many people are unaware that it is derived from Gypsy.
